Why These Are the Top Flooring Installers Contractors in Wolf Lake

The flooring installers market serving Wolf Lake, MN is characterized by a reliance on established contractors from the larger nearby commercial center of Detroit Lakes, approximately 15-20 minutes away. As a small, rural community, Wolf Lake itself does not host multiple dedicated flooring companies. The market is moderately competitive among the regional providers, who have built their reputations on longevity, word-of-mouth, and high-quality craftsmanship typical of a local, service-oriented economy. The average quality of service is generally high, with contractors often being multi-generational or long-term residents, which fosters accountability. Typical pricing is competitive with regional averages. For a standard installation, homeowners can expect to pay in the range of $3-$8 per square foot for laminate/LVP, $5-$12+ per square foot for tile, and $8-$15+ per square foot for hardwood, with refinishing and complex subfloor leveling adding to the project cost. The most successful providers differentiate themselves through exceptional customer service, robust warranties, and expertise in handling the specific challenges of older homes common in the area.

1How does Wolf Lake's climate affect my choice of flooring material?

Wolf Lake's significant temperature swings and high humidity in summer demand durable, dimensionally stable flooring. Engineered hardwood, luxury vinyl plank (LVP), and tile are excellent choices as they resist warping and contraction better than solid hardwood in our climate. For basements, which can be damp, moisture-resistant options like LVP or ceramic tile are highly recommended to prevent mold and mildew.

2What is the typical timeline for a flooring installation project in this area, and are there seasonal considerations?

For a standard room, professional installation typically takes 1-3 days, but scheduling can be impacted by Minnesota's seasons. Late spring through early fall is the busiest period, so book several weeks in advance. Winter installations are possible, but we must carefully acclimate flooring materials indoors for 48-72 hours upon delivery to adjust from the extreme cold to your home's heated environment.

3What should I look for when choosing a local Wolf Lake flooring installer?

Prioritize licensed and insured local contractors with verifiable references in Becker County. A reputable installer will conduct an in-home assessment to check for subfloor issues common in older Minnesota homes, such as moisture or uneven joists. They should also be knowledgeable about proper installation methods for our climate and provide a detailed, written estimate that includes all material, labor, and disposal costs.

4Are there specific local regulations or disposal concerns for old flooring in Wolf Lake?

Yes, Becker County has specific waste disposal guidelines. Carpet padding and certain types of old vinyl flooring cannot be disposed of with regular trash and must go to the Becker County Transfer Station. A professional local installer will handle this responsibly, including any fees, and will know the local regulations for disposing of construction debris, saving you the hassle and potential fines.

5What are the common cost factors for flooring installation in Wolf Lake compared to larger cities?

While material costs are similar statewide, labor rates in Wolf Lake may be slightly lower than in the Twin Cities metro. However, travel costs for materials and crews can be a factor given our rural location. The final price is most influenced by the material chosen (e.g., laminate vs. hardwood), the complexity of the job (patterned tile vs. simple planks), and the condition of your existing subfloor, which often requires leveling in older Northwoods homes.
